This picture was taken on Leipziger Platz, only 50 metres away from Potsdamer Platz. This square used to be in the "strip of death" during GDR times. While the Potsdamer Platz was rebuilt as one of the first ones they started building houses on Leipziger Platz much later. The left building with the huge Samsung ad and the building in the middle with the 5% ad are not real buildings. It is a gigantic photo and it shows what the building will look like in the future.

The second building from left with the flag on top is the Canadian Embassy.
